«tar» 태그된 질문

tar 파일 형식 작업을위한 tar 아카이브 형식 및 / 또는 명령 줄 유틸리티

1
디렉토리에 여러 파일을 tar하는 방법이 있습니까 (Linux / Unix)?
tar디렉토리의 여러 파일에 대해 매우 간단한 방법이 있습니까? 예를 들어 다음이 디렉토리라고 가정 해 봅시다. -rw-r--r-- 1 allend bin 98 Jul 20 15:50 scriptlog.log -rw-r--r-- 1 allend bin 19533 Jul 29 21:47 serveralert.log -rwxr--r-- 1 allend bin 1625 Jul 29 21:47 orion -rw-r--r-- 1 allend bin 24064 Jul 29 21:49 …
26 files  tar 

3
bash에서 tar 파일 무결성 테스트
'.tar'파일을 만드는 bash 스크립트가 있습니다. 파일이 생성되면 무결성을 테스트하고 무결성이 나쁜 경우 루트 사용자에게 전자 메일을 보내려고합니다. tar -tf /root/archive.tar파일의 무결성을 확인 하기 위해 명령을 사용해야한다는 것을 알고 있지만 bash if 문에서 어떻게 구현하고 오류를 확인합니까?
25 bash  tar 

7
tar + rsync + untar. rsync보다 속도 이점이 있습니까?
10K-100K의 파일을 가진 폴더를 원격 컴퓨터 (캠퍼스 내 동일한 네트워크 내)로 보내는 경우가 종종 있습니다. 믿을만한 이유가 있는지 궁금해서 tar + rsync + untar 아니면 간단히 tar (from src to dest) + untar 실제로보다 빠를 수 있습니다 rsync 처음으로 파일 을 전송할 때 . 압축을 사용하고 사용하지 않는 두 가지 …
25 rsync  tar 

4
tarball을 추출 할 때 대상 디렉토리 작성
mkdir -ptar 명령 내에 존재하지 않는 대상 디렉토리를 정의 할 수있는 곳 과 비슷한 대상 디렉토리를 작성할 수 있습니까? tar는 나를 위해 디렉토리를 작성합니까? 를 사용하여 출력을 디렉토리로 리디렉션 할 수 있다는 것을 알고 tar -C /target/dir있지만 대상 디렉토리가 없으면 작동하지 않습니다.
25 directory  tar 

3
tar cvf 또는 tar -cvf?
옵션에 대해 '-'없이 tar를 사용하는 방법을 배웠지 tar cvfz dir.tar.gz Directory/만 최근에 약간 다른 tar -czvf구문 에 도달 했습니다 (이 경우 'f'가 마지막 옵션이어야합니다). 둘 다 리눅스와 Mac OS에서 작동합니다. '-'없이 ou와 함께 권장되는 구문이 있습니까?


3
상대 경로가있는 tar
상대 경로를 사용하여 tar를 사용하여 아카이브를 만들려고합니다. 다음 명령을 사용합니다. tar czf ~/files/wp/my-page-order.tar.gz -C ~/webapps/zers/wp-content/plugins/ ~/webapps/zers/wp-content/plugins/my-page-order 그러나 보관 된 파일에는 여전히 절대 경로가 있습니다. 상대 경로와 함께 tar를 사용하려면 어떻게해야합니까?
24 tar 

4
가장 빠른 방법은 많은 파일을 하나로 결합합니다 (tar czf가 너무 느림).
현재 tar czf백업 파일을 결합하기 위해 실행 중 입니다. 파일은 특정 디렉토리에 있습니다. 그러나 파일 수가 증가하고 있습니다. 사용하는 tzr czf데 시간이 너무 오래 걸립니다 (20 분 이상 소요). 파일을보다 빠르고 확장 가능한 방식으로 결합해야합니다. 내가 발견 한 genisoimage, readom및 mkisofs. 그러나 나는 어느 것이 가장 빠르며 각각의 한계가 무엇인지 …
23 backup  tar  archive 

3
쉘 명령에서. ?? *는 무엇을 의미합니까?
다음 명령 것 tar모두 "점"파일 및 폴더 : tar -zcvf dotfiles.tar.gz .??* 나는 정규 표현식에 익숙 하지만 해석 방법을 이해하지 못한다 .??*. 나는 나열된 파일을 실행 ls .??*하고 tree .??*보았다. 예를 들어이 정규식에 폴더 내 모든 파일이 포함 .됩니까?
22 wildcards  tar 


2
하드 링크 역 참조
tar명령 매뉴얼 페이지에는 하드 링크를 따르는 옵션이 나열되어 있습니다. -h, --dereference follow symlinks; archive and dump the files they point to --hard-dereference follow hard links; archive and dump the files they refer to tar파일이 하드 링크라는 것을 어떻게 알 수 있습니까? 그것을 어떻게 따르 나요? 이 옵션을 선택하지 않으면 어떻게됩니까? …
22 tar  hard-link 

4
Linux Alpine에서 "tar : invalid magic"오류를 해결하는 방법
Alpine Linux에 sqlite를 설치하고 있습니다. 다운로드 sqlite-autoconf-3130000.tar.gz했지만 tar열 수 없습니다. 이 답변을 시도했지만 작동하지 않습니다. tar이 메시지를 제공합니다 : tar: invalid magic tar: short read 나는이 명령들을 썼다. wget https://www.sqlite.org/2015/sqlite-autoconf-3090100.tar.gz tar -zxvf sqlite-autoconf-3090100.tar.gz
22 tar  alpine-linux 

2
출력 파일이 / dev / null 일 때 tar가 파일 내용을 건너 뛰는 이유는 무엇입니까?
400 GiB 이상의 데이터가있는 디렉토리가 있습니다. 내가 생각하는 간단한 방법은이었다, 그래서 모든 파일이 오류없이 읽을 수 있는지 확인하고 싶었다 tar로 /dev/null. 그러나 대신 다음과 같은 동작이 나타납니다. $ time tar cf /dev/null . real 0m4.387s user 0m3.462s sys 0m0.185s $ time tar cf - . > /dev/null real 0m3.130s user …
21 tar  null 

3
tar 파일의 내용을 소유자와 그룹에 강제로 적용 하시겠습니까?
파일이 만들어지는 시스템에 존재하지 않는 owner : group 쌍에 속하는 내용으로 tar 파일을 만들고 싶습니다. 내가 시도한 방향은 다음과 같습니다. tar ca --owner='otherowner' --group='othergroup' mydata.tgz mydata 그리고이 명령을 실행할 때 다음 오류가 발생합니다. tar: otherowner: Invalid owner tar: Error is not recoverable: exiting now tar 파일이 파일을 작성하는 시스템에 존재하지 …
21 permissions  users  tar 

4
내부에서 파일을 압축하는 방법
하드 디스크 사용량이 90 % 인 머신이 있습니다. 500 개 이상의 로그 파일을 더 작은 새 파일로 압축하고 싶습니다. 그러나 하드 디스크는 너무 작아서 원본 파일과 압축 파일을 모두 보관할 수 없습니다. 따라서 필요한 것은 모든 로그 파일을 하나씩 새 파일로 하나씩 압축하여 압축 한 각 원본을 삭제하는 것입니다. Linux에서 …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.